About the Item

Stylish French Napoleon III 'porte revue' magazine rack or canterbury. Black lacquered and beautifully turned wood, this four-sectioned stand with an undershelf, and carrying that handle, will work well within a diverse range of interior styles. In good condition with nice age-related patina. Dimensions: H 48cm/18.89in. W42cm/16.53in. D35/13.77in.
